Dear Lakeland Customers,

June 1st through November 30th is Florida’s official hurricane season. We know from past experience that these terrible storms can be unpredictable and devastating in their power and ability to cause damage. They have left our homes and businesses without power for hours, days and even weeks.

I think we learned that being prepared early and being constantly watchful during a threat is critical. There should be no excuse for any of us not to be prepared for this year's storm season.

Rest assured Lakeland Electric is planning for the safety of the community’s electrical system.

During a hurricane, Lakeland Electric will implement its own in-house Emergency Operations Plan. Part of this plan involves the monumental job of restoring utility equipment and electric service to our customers. We will do everything humanly possible to quickly and safely achieve restoration as soon as the storm danger passes. Once again, we utilized our lessons learned from previous hurricane seasons and have continuously fine-tuned our plan.

Download your copy of the “2009 Hurricane Guide” so you can be better prepared to plan for the safety of your family. I urge you to thoroughly review this guide and keep it close at hand during hurricane season.

Your cooperation and patience are key to the success of these plans.

Let’s work together to keep our community safe.
